Abstract

Compositions containing a lactic acid-producing bacterial strain, e.g., Bacillus coagulans for inhibition of pathogenic bacterial infections. Spores or extracellular products produced by the bacterial strains are also useful as inhibitory agents.

Claims (11)

1. A method of maintaining gastrointestinal tract health comprising administering to the gastrointestinal tract of a mammal a composition comprising an isolated Bacillus coagulans GBI-30 strain (ATCC Designation Number PTA-6086), wherein said strain colonizes the gastrointestinal tract of said mammal to maintain gastrointestinal health.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ition is administered orally, buccally, or nasally.

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ition is administered in a food or as a food supplement.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said strain produces lactic acid and has an optimal growth temperature of in the range of 25-35° C.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ein said strain produces lactic acid and has an optimal growth temperature of 30° C.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ein said strain produces L(+) dextrorotatory lactic acid and produces spores resistant to temperatures of up to approximately 90° C.

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ition comprises a viable Bacillus coagulans GBI-30 strain (ATCC Designation Number PTA-6086) vegetative bacterial cell.

8.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ition comprises a viable Bacillus coagulans GBI-30 strain (ATCC Designation Number PTA-6086) bacterial spore.

9.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ition comprises 1×10 3 to 1×10 14 CFU of Bacillus coagulans GBI-30 strain (ATCC Designation Number PTA-6086).

10.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ition comprises 1×10 8 to 1×10 10 CFU of Bacillus coagulans GBI-30 strain (ATCC Designation Number PTA-6086).

11. The method of claim 1 , wherein said composition comprises 1×10 9 CFU of Bacillus coagulans GBI-30 strain (ATCC Designation Number PTA-6086).
